Story summary
- President Trump increased tariffs on steel and aluminum imports to 50%, impacting over 400 goods, effective Monday.
- This action aims to protect domestic industries but may raise compliance costs and consumer prices.
- The tariffs now affect $328 billion in imports, contributing to inflationary pressures.
- The logistics industry encounters difficulties due to the sudden implementation without exemptions for in-transit goods.
